Manama: Indian, formerly Indian Airlines, will get a new country manager for Bahrain from July 22.
Niranjan Kumar, formerly the airline's airport manager, will take over from Sanjay Misra, who is moving to the East Indian city of Kolkata where he will be deputy general manager.
Misra is expected to leave Bahrain on July 25.
